Output 2f08d823b0b6bd1a750d1de4b7a7c786366af6e997cd86f2bb0c6dd179328fc7:3

value
4138560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8effea336980c7740d3c06e33d36dae29a3ef7a OP_EQUAL
address
3QPH1EtUNz2HvFQEWQYZuikNHu8WU1yJuW
transaction
2f08d823b0b6bd1a750d1de4b7a7c786366af6e997cd86f2bb0c6dd179328fc7
spent
true